easyexcel-plus
时间: 2024-12-27 14:23:07 浏览: 3
### EasyExcel-Plus 技术信息与使用指南
#### 易于使用的增强版 Excel 处理库
EasyExcel-Plus 是基于阿里巴巴开源的 EasyExcel 进行二次封装和扩展的一个 Java 库,旨在简化并提高开发者在处理 Excel 文件时的工作效率[^1]。
#### 功能特性
该库不仅继承了原生 EasyExcel 的高效读写能力,还增加了更多实用的功能模块:
- 支持复杂表头解析
- 提供更加简洁的数据映射方式
- 增强异常捕获机制
- 完善的日志记录体系
这些改进使得 EasyExcel-Plus 成为了处理大型 Excel 表格数据的理想选择之一。
#### Maven 依赖配置
要在项目中引入 EasyExcel-Plus,可以在 `pom.xml` 中添加如下依赖声明:
```xml
<dependency>
<groupId>com.github.easyexcel</groupId>
<artifactId>easyexcel-plus</artifactId>
<version>最新版本号</version>
</dependency>
```
请注意替换上述代码中的 "最新版本号" 字段为实际发布的稳定版本编号。具体版本信息可以参考官方文档或仓库页面获取最新的发布说明。
#### 示例代码展示
下面是一段简单的例子来演示如何利用 EasyExcel-Plus 实现 Excel 文件的导入操作:
```java
import com.alibaba.excel.EasyExcel;
import java.util.List;
public class ImportExample {
public static void main(String[] args) throws Exception{
String fileName = "path/to/your/excel/file.xlsx";
List<DataModel> dataList = EasyExcel.read(fileName).sheet().doReadSync();
System.out.println(dataList);
}
}
```
此示例展示了基本文件读取流程以及同步执行模式下的简单用法。对于更复杂的场景,则可以根据需求调整参数设置以满足特定业务逻辑的要求。
阅读全文